101 to 125 of 252 Clean Code Jobs in the UK

Java 8 Software Engineer | £500 – £550 | Inside IR35 | 6 Months | Hybrid Remote

Hiring Organisation
Opus Recruitment Solutions Ltd
Location
London, South East, England, United Kingdom
Employment Type
Contractor
Contract Rate
£500 - £550 per day
Hibernate development practices Proven ability to build microservices and reliable RESTful APIs Hands-on experience applying TDD and BDD testing approaches Good understanding of clean coding principles, SOLID, and cloud technologies Previous experience in Finance/Fintech/Payments is highly beneficial Key Responsibilities Design, implement, and thoroughly test ...

Back End Developer

Hiring Organisation
Osdire
Location
Liverpool, England, United Kingdom
systems that support core marketplace functionality and evolving business requirements. Key ResponsibilitiesSystem Architecture & Development Design and implement scalable, maintainable backend architecture Apply SOLID principles, clean code practices, and clear separation of concerns Develop modular components using service-layer and repository patterns Core Platform Features User authentication and role … queues Architecture & Tooling Service-layer and repository patterns RESTful API design and authentication Event-driven architecture (Laravel Events & Listeners) Git, Composer, PHPUnit/Pest Code quality tools (PHP Insights, Pint/CS Fixer) Performance & Testing Query optimisation and N+1 prevention Queue and memory optimisation TDD mindset and integration testing ...

Data Engineer

Hiring Organisation
Anson McCade
Location
Newcastle Upon Tyne, England, United Kingdom
lineage, and security across all pipelines Deploy data applications using CI/CD pipelines (Azure DevOps, GitHub Actions, Jenkins) Manage infrastructure using Infrastructure as Code tools such as Terraform or CloudFormation Work with containerised environments using Docker and Kubernetes Collaborate closely with analytics, product, and AI teams to deliver … clean, usable datasets Support code reviews, best practices, and knowledge sharing across the team Provide guidance and mentorship to junior engineers where appropriate Ideal Background Third-level education in a relevant field such as Computer Science, Data Science, Artificial Intelligence, or similar Minimum 2 years’ experience in data ...

Cloud DevOps Engineer

Hiring Organisation
Anson Mccade
Location
London, United Kingdom
Employment Type
Permanent, Work From Home
Cloud DevOps Engineer Designing and delivering secure, scalable systems on AWS Developing and maintaining applications using modern cloud-native services Applying Infrastructure-as-Code (IaC) approaches using CloudFormation, CDK or Terraform Writing clean, maintainable code in at least one Lambda-compatible language Scripting automation tasks using Shell ...

Cloud DevOps Engineer

Hiring Organisation
Anson Mccade
Location
Bristol, Avon, South West, United Kingdom
Employment Type
Permanent, Work From Home
Cloud DevOps Engineer Designing and delivering secure, scalable systems on AWS Developing and maintaining applications using modern cloud-native services Applying Infrastructure-as-Code (IaC) approaches using CloudFormation, CDK or Terraform Writing clean, maintainable code in at least one Lambda-compatible language Scripting automation tasks using Shell ...

Senior Data Engineer (AWS, Airflow, DBT)

Hiring Organisation
Harnham - Data & Analytics Recruitment
Location
Nottingham, Nottinghamshire, England,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£100,000 per annum
data models aligned with industry best practices Ensuring high standards of data quality through testing, monitoring and alerting Driving engineering best practices, contributing to code reviews and mentoring other engineers YOUR SKILLS AND EXPERIENCE: You will bring strong capability in: Python and advanced SQL Building and maintaining production-grade … pipelines Modern data orchestration tools (e.g. Dagster, Airflow, Prefect) Data modelling methodologies (Kimball, Data Vault, etc.) Engineering best practices including testing, version control and clean code AWS experience THE BENEFITS: You will receive a salary of up to £100,000 depending on experience, along with a comprehensive benefits ...

Senior Data Engineer (AWS, Airflow, DBT)

Hiring Organisation
Harnham - Data & Analytics Recruitment
Location
Manchester, Lancashire, England,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£100,000 per annum
data models aligned with industry best practices Ensuring high standards of data quality through testing, monitoring and alerting Driving engineering best practices, contributing to code reviews and mentoring other engineers YOUR SKILLS AND EXPERIENCE: You will bring strong capability in: Python and advanced SQL Building and maintaining production-grade … pipelines Modern data orchestration tools (e.g. Dagster, Airflow, Prefect) Data modelling methodologies (Kimball, Data Vault, etc.) Engineering best practices including testing, version control and clean code AWS experience THE BENEFITS: You will receive a salary of up to £100,000 depending on experience, along with a comprehensive benefits ...

Senior Data Engineer (AWS, Airflow, DBT)

Hiring Organisation
Harnham - Data & Analytics Recruitment
Location
Edinburgh, Midlothian, Scotland,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£100,000 per annum
data models aligned with industry best practices Ensuring high standards of data quality through testing, monitoring and alerting Driving engineering best practices, contributing to code reviews and mentoring other engineers YOUR SKILLS AND EXPERIENCE: You will bring strong capability in: Python and advanced SQL Building and maintaining production-grade … pipelines Modern data orchestration tools (e.g. Dagster, Airflow, Prefect) Data modelling methodologies (Kimball, Data Vault, etc.) Engineering best practices including testing, version control and clean code AWS experience THE BENEFITS: You will receive a salary of up to £100,000 depending on experience, along with a comprehensive benefits ...

Senior Data Engineer (AWS, Airflow, DBT)

Hiring Organisation
Harnham - Data & Analytics Recruitment
Location
Birmingham, West Midlands, England,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£100,000 per annum
data models aligned with industry best practices Ensuring high standards of data quality through testing, monitoring and alerting Driving engineering best practices, contributing to code reviews and mentoring other engineers YOUR SKILLS AND EXPERIENCE: You will bring strong capability in: Python and advanced SQL Building and maintaining production-grade … pipelines Modern data orchestration tools (e.g. Dagster, Airflow, Prefect) Data modelling methodologies (Kimball, Data Vault, etc.) Engineering best practices including testing, version control and clean code AWS experience THE BENEFITS: You will receive a salary of up to £100,000 depending on experience, along with a comprehensive benefits ...

Senior Data Engineer (AWS, Airflow, DBT)

Hiring Organisation
Harnham - Data & Analytics Recruitment
Location
Cardiff, South Glamorgan, Wales,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£100,000 per annum
data models aligned with industry best practices Ensuring high standards of data quality through testing, monitoring and alerting Driving engineering best practices, contributing to code reviews and mentoring other engineers YOUR SKILLS AND EXPERIENCE: You will bring strong capability in: Python and advanced SQL Building and maintaining production-grade … pipelines Modern data orchestration tools (e.g. Dagster, Airflow, Prefect) Data modelling methodologies (Kimball, Data Vault, etc.) Engineering best practices including testing, version control and clean code AWS experience THE BENEFITS: You will receive a salary of up to £100,000 depending on experience, along with a comprehensive benefits ...

Senior Data Engineer (AWS, Airflow, DBT)

Hiring Organisation
Harnham - Data & Analytics Recruitment
Location
Leeds, West Yorkshire, England, United Kingdom
Employment Type
Full-Time
Salary
£80,000 - £100,000 per annum
data models aligned with industry best practices Ensuring high standards of data quality through testing, monitoring and alerting Driving engineering best practices, contributing to code reviews and mentoring other engineers YOUR SKILLS AND EXPERIENCE: You will bring strong capability in: Python and advanced SQL Building and maintaining production-grade … pipelines Modern data orchestration tools (e.g. Dagster, Airflow, Prefect) Data modelling methodologies (Kimball, Data Vault, etc.) Engineering best practices including testing, version control and clean code AWS experience THE BENEFITS: You will receive a salary of up to £100,000 depending on experience, along with a comprehensive benefits ...

Senior Software Engineer (Full Stack)

Hiring Organisation
Perch Group
Location
Manchester Area, United Kingdom
also contributing to the UI/UX and full stack component of our modernisation journey . You will help shape our future architecture, improve code quality, refactor legacy components , and build modern frontend experiences . This is a hands-on role with a clear progression path to Tech Lead … front‐end framework (eg React). Implement public facing websites using a Content Management System (CMS) and integrate with our back-end systems. Implement clean, maintainable code using SOLID principles and design patterns Collaborate with architecture and product teams to deliver high-quality software at pace Refactor ...

Senior Web Application Developer

Hiring Organisation
Scientis Search Ltd
Location
Middleton Stoney, Oxfordshire, UK
systems Translate user and customer requirements into robust software solutions Develop data analysis and visualisation tools for real-time and post-processed data Write clean, scalable code using C#, .NET Core, ASP.NET and modern front-end technologies (JavaScript, TypeScript, React, HTML) Follow best practices in coding standards, documentation ...

Senior Web Application Developer

Hiring Organisation
Scientis Search Ltd
Location
Middleton Stoney, England, United Kingdom
systems Translate user and customer requirements into robust software solutions Develop data analysis and visualisation tools for real-time and post-processed data Write clean, scalable code using C#, .NET Core, ASP.NET and modern front-end technologies (JavaScript, TypeScript, React, HTML) Follow best practices in coding standards, documentation ...

Senior Front End Developer

Hiring Organisation
Birketts LLP
Location
Ipswich, Suffolk, England, United Kingdom
Employment Type
Full-Time
Salary
Competitive salary
practical implementation approaches Implement, test and maintain new user interface functionality, ensuring changes are robust, maintainable and aligned with agreed standards Participate actively in code reviews and technical design reviews, providing constructive feedback and helping maintain code quality across the front end Contribute to improving consistency and usability … Solid HTML5 and CSS skills, including building responsive interfaces that work well across devices and browsers Good understanding of maintainable engineering practices (e.g. writing clean, testable code, sensible separation of concerns, and effective peer review) Experience working with modern Web application patterns, including server-side rendering (or similar ...

PHP Developer

Hiring Organisation
Spectrum IT Recruitment
Location
Romsey, Hampshire, United Kingdom
Employment Type
Permanent
Salary
£45000 - £50000/annum plus hybrid working and benefits
What You'll Bring 3+ years' experience in backend development Strong PHP & Laravel skills Solid PostgreSQL and API development experience A passion for clean code and building things properly Nice to Have AWS/cloud experience CI/CD knowledge Interest in AI tools (Copilot, Claude etc.) Interested ...

Senior AI Engineer

Hiring Organisation
Enablis
Location
Leeds, England, United Kingdom
Evaluating emerging AI tools, frameworks and protocols Supporting pragmatic AI adoption across engineering teams What We’re Looking For Essential: Strong software engineering foundations (clean code, testing, CI/CD, production mindset) Hands-on experience with LLMs (API integrations, prompt engineering, agent workflows, RAG systems) Experience shipping ...

Web Developer

Hiring Organisation
Zazu Digital Talent
Location
United Kingdom
automation to improve workflows and efficiency What We're Looking For We need someone who understands that great ecommerce development goes beyond writing clean code - it's about commercial outcomes, customer experience and enabling growth. You will likely bring: Strong hands-on Shopify Plus experience - this ...

Senior Front End Developer

Hiring Organisation
Searchability (UK) Ltd
Location
Bromley, London, United Kingdom
Employment Type
Permanent, Work From Home
Salary
£80,000
improve front-end performance, and contribute to best practices across the team. This role would suit someone who enjoys ownership, problem-solving, and building clean, maintainable code. SENIOR FRONT END DEVELOPER ESSENTIAL SKILLS Strong commercial experience with Vue.js Solid JavaScript (ES6+) experience Strong HTML and CSS skills Experience building ...

Graduate Software Developer | 50,000–60,000 | Hybrid (London / Remote).

Hiring Organisation
IT Graduate Recruitment
Location
London, South East, England, United Kingdom
Employment Type
Full-Time
Salary
£50,000 - £60,000 per annum, OTE
Ready to build software that actually matters? Join a team where you’ll be solving real-world problems from day one — not just writing code in the corner. We’re looking for an ambitious Graduate Software Developer who loves tackling technical challenges, learning fast, and working with smart, supportive … Stack Engineer role within 12–24 months. What You’ll Do Design and build high-performance software used by thousands of users daily Develop clean, efficient, and scalable code in Python, C++ or JavaScript Collaborate with engineers, data scientists, and product teams on exciting new features Contribute ...

Java Full Stack Engineer

Hiring Organisation
Consulting Point
Location
England, United Kingdom
building cloud-native digital platforms and modern web applications. You’ll work closely with clients to understand their needs and deliver value through clean, scalable, and secure code that makes a real impact. Requirements: Strong experience developing microservices with Java and the Spring Boot framework Experience with Docker … with platforms like GitHub or GitLab Comfortable working in agile delivery teams with strong collaboration and communication skills Desirable Experience: Familiarity with Infrastructure as Code tools like Terraform Experience working with NoSQL databases (such as MongoDB) or SQL databases (such as Postgres) Awareness of accessibility, coding standards, and development ...

Senior Software Engineer

Hiring Organisation
Osborne Appointments
Location
Milton Keynes, Buckinghamshire, United Kingdom
Employment Type
Permanent
Salary
£70000/annum + Benefits
Importantly, this is not a “build from scratch” role — the platform is already established. The focus will be on maintaining, improving, and optimising existing code, ensuring performance, stability, and scalability as the business evolves. Benefits: Opportunity to be instrumental in building an in-house development function Clear progression into … high-quality solutions Maintain and optimise MySQL databases, schemas, and queries Contribute to frontend development using modern JavaScript frameworks (React, Vue or similar) Conduct code reviews and implement best practice across development Support production systems, troubleshooting and resolving issues as required Work alongside external contractors, with a view ...

Frontend Developer

Hiring Organisation
Rullion Limited
Location
United Kingdom
Employment Type
Contract, Work From Home
functional agile team that includes backend engineers, designers, and product managers. Translate design mock-ups and prototypes into pixel-perfect, performant user interfaces. Ensure code quality through practices such as code reviews, testing, and continuous integration. Contribute to discussions on UI/UX improvements and technical feasibility. Optimize …/or GraphQL integration. Proficiency with version control systems like Git. Understanding of frontend testing frameworks (Jest, Testing Library, Cypress). Appreciation for clean, maintainable code and best practices such as TDD and code reviews. Strong communication skills and a collaborative mindset. A keen eye for detail ...

Lead Gameplay Developer

Hiring Organisation
Couch Heroes
Location
United Kingdom
discipline in cross-discipline leads meetings, production planning, and resourcing conversations. Advocate for team needs and capacity. Foster a team culture of technical rigour, clean code practices, and collaborative problem solving. Support hiring as the team grows: contribute to job descriptions, design technical assessments, and participate in interview … support for every change. Stay hands-on with C++ and Blueprint implementation. Build, profile, and iterate alongside your engineers, establishing technical quality benchmarks and code architecture patterns. Work with animation, VFX, and audio teams to integrate gameplay systems with presentation layers: ability visuals, hit feedback, audio cues ...

AI Software Engineer

Hiring Organisation
Fruition Group
Location
North West London, London, United Kingdom
Employment Type
Permanent, Work From Home
powered client solutions, including RAG pipelines, agent architectures, LLM integrations, and protocol-driven tooling Build scalable AI systems using modern software engineering best practice (clean code, testing, CI/CD) Develop internal AI tooling to accelerate engineering delivery Lead advanced AI knowledge-sharing sessions within internal upskilling initiatives ...